1.su
su命令是最基本的命令之一,常用于不同用戶間切換。
例如,如果登錄為user1翔试,要切換為user2,只要用如下命令:
$su user2
然后系統(tǒng)提示輸入user2口令复旬,輸入正確的口令之后就可以切換到user2垦缅。
完成之后就可以用exit命令返回到user1。
su命令的常見用法是變成根用戶或超級用戶驹碍。如果發(fā)出不帶用戶名的su命令 失都,則系統(tǒng)提示輸入根口令,輸入之后則可切換為根用戶幸冻。
如果登錄為?根用戶粹庞,則可以用su命令成為系統(tǒng)上任何用戶而不需要口令。
2. Pwd
pwd命令也是最常用最基本的命令之一洽损,用于顯示用戶當(dāng)前所在的目錄庞溜。
[root@localhost ~]# pwd
/root
[liulian@localhost root]$ pwd
/root
[liulian@localhost ~]$ pwd
/home/liulian
3. Cd
cd命令不僅顯示當(dāng)前狀態(tài),還改變當(dāng)前狀態(tài),它的用法跟dos下的cd命令基本一致流码。
cd ..?可進(jìn)入上一層目錄
cd -??可進(jìn)入上一個進(jìn)入的目錄
cd ~??可進(jìn)入用戶的home目錄
4.ls
ls命令跟dos下的dir命令一樣又官,用于顯示當(dāng)前目錄的內(nèi)容。
如果想取得詳細(xì)的信息漫试,可用ls -l命令六敬, 這樣就可以顯示目錄內(nèi)容的詳細(xì)信息。
如果目錄下的文件太多驾荣,用一屏顯示不了外构,可以用ls -l |more分屏顯示 。
5.find
find命令用于查找文件播掷。這個命令可以按文件名审编、建立或修改日期、所有者(通常是建立文件的用戶)歧匈、文件長度或文件類型進(jìn)行搜索垒酬。
find命令的基本結(jié)構(gòu)如下:
$find
其中指定從哪個目錄開始搜索。指定搜索條件件炉。表示找到文件怎么處理勘究。一般來說,要用-print動作斟冕,顯示 整個文件路徑和名
稱口糕。如果沒有這個動作,則find命令進(jìn)行所要搜索而不顯示結(jié)果宫静,等于白費勁走净。
例如,要搜索系統(tǒng)上所有名稱為ye的文件孤里,可用如下命令:
$find / -name ye?-print
這樣就可以顯示出系統(tǒng)上所有名稱為ye的文件伏伯。
[liulian@localhost ~]$ find / -name ye -print
6.Mkdir
這個命令很簡單,跟dos的md命令用法幾乎一樣捌袜,用于建立目錄说搅。
7.cp
cp命令用于復(fù)制文件或目錄。
cp命令可以一次復(fù)制多個文件虏等,例如:
$cp *.txt *.doc *.bak /home
將當(dāng)前目錄中擴(kuò)展名為txt弄唧、doc和bak的文件全部復(fù)制到/home目錄中。
如果要復(fù)制整個目錄及其所有子目錄霍衫,可以用cp -R命令候引。
8.Rm
rm命令用于刪除文件或目錄。
rm命令會強制刪除文件敦跌,如果想要在刪除時提示確認(rèn)澄干,可用rm -i命令。
如果要刪除目錄,可用rm -r命令麸俘。rm -r命令在刪除目錄時辩稽,每刪除一個文件或目錄都會顯示提示,如果目錄太大从媚,響應(yīng)每個
提示是不現(xiàn)實的逞泄。這時可以用rm -rf命令來強制刪除目錄,這樣即使用了-i標(biāo)志也當(dāng)無效處理拜效。
9.mv
mv命令用于移動文件和更名文件喷众。例如:
$mv ye.txt /home
將當(dāng)前目錄下的ye.txt文件移動到/home目錄下,
$mv ye.txt ye1.txt
將ye.txt文件改名為ye1.txt拂檩。
類似于跟cp命令侮腹,mv命令也可以一次移動多個文件嘲碧,在此不再贅敘稻励。
10.reboot
重啟命令,不必多說愈涩。
11.halt
關(guān)機命令望抽,不必多說。